Abstract
A surface acoustic wave element includes multilayer electrodes having much higher electric power durability compared to conventional surface acoustic wave elements. The multilayer electrodes are prepared by forming, on a piezoelectric substrate, a Ti base electrode film that improves the orientation characteristics of the multilayer electrodes, an Al-type electrode film, an electrode film having a diffusive material that can easily diffuse into the grain boundary of the Al electrode film, and then an Al electrode film, in this order.
